CD Recording Options
Depending on your CD drive, Studio offers a number
of recording options. The choices are found in the
CD/Voice-over tab (Setup > CD and Voice-over):
The default method is digitally “ripping” from your CD
to Studio, where the audio is transferred digitally. If
you have an older CD drive and can’t rip, Studio lists
alternative options based on your audio board.
The SmartSound tool
SmartSound automatically creates background
music in the style of your choice. Within that
style, you select one of several songs, and within that
song, any of a number of versions. The list of versions
available also depends on the duration of background
music you specify.
